§ 21-10-10 — House of ill fame declared nuisance--Injunction and abatement.

Text

Whoever shall own, lease, establish, maintain, or operate any place for purposes of lewdness, assignation, or prostitution, is guilty of a nuisance and the place, including ground, and all contents are declared a nuisance and shall be enjoined and abated as provided in §§ 21-10-11 to 21-10-20 , inclusive.

Legislative History

SL 1913, ch 123, § 1; RC 1919, § 2078; SDC 1939 & Supp 1960, § 37.4801.
